What is an X-Ray?
An X-Ray is a simple and painless test that takes detailed pictures of the inside of your body. They are mainly used to study bones and joints and are sometimes used to look at internal organs. The X-Ray machine uses a tube to produce an X-Ray beam that is carefully aimed at the part of the body being examined.
Are X-Rays safe?
If you are having an X-Ray, you will be exposed to some radiation. However, the part of your body being examined will only be exposed for a fraction of a second. The dose of radiation from a standard X-Ray is the same amount of radiation that the average person receives from 10 days of naturally occurring background radiation. Your doctor will have referred you for an X-Ray having fully assessed all possible risks and benefits.
Will it be comfortable?
X-Rays are painless and our team will ensure you are as comfortable as much as possible.
Preparation
You don’t need to do anything special to prepare for your scan; a few simple instructions below:
On the day of your appointment you will need to arrive about 15 minutes before your appointment time.
Leave valuable possessions, such as jewellery and watches, at home.
The scan/What to expect
You may be required to wear a hospital gown and remove any items that have metal (for example, glasses, jewellery and watches).
You may also be asked to hold your breath during the scan to avoid blurry images.
The radiographer may ask you to change position to allow images from different viewpoints.
After the scan
Patients are able to leave immediately after their X-Ray and can carry on with their normal activities.
Results are usually ready within 24-48 hours and sent to the referring clinician.
